Noack, Peter; Kracke, Barbel; Gniewosz, Burkhard; Dietrich, Julia – Journal of Vocational Behavior, 2010
The study examines school and parental influences on adolescents' occupational exploration. Analyses of data from 859 6th, 8th, and 10th graders attending high- and lower-track high schools in the German federal state of Thuringia suggested more extensive exploration among students closer to the school-to-work transition.
